Description
o-(2-Trifluoromethyl-Phenyl)-Hydroxylamine is a specialized aromatic hydroxylamine derivative featuring a trifluoromethyl substituent in the ortho position. This compound is a high-value pharmaceutical intermediate and organic synthesis building block, prized for its unique reactivity profile that enables the introduction of hydroxylamine and amine functionalities into complex molecules. It is primarily utilized by research institutions and manufacturers in the pharmaceutical and agrochemical sectors for the development of novel active ingredients.
Application
- Pharmaceutical Intermediate: Key building block in the synthesis of drug candidates, particularly those targeting central nervous system (CNS) disorders and inflammatory diseases.
- Agrochemical Synthesis: Used in the research and production of advanced herbicides, fungicides, and insecticides, leveraging the bioactivity of the hydroxylamine moiety.
- Organic Synthesis Reagent: Serves as a versatile reagent for the preparation of oximes, nitrones, and other nitrogen-containing heterocycles in fine chemical production.
- Material Science Research: Employed in the development of novel polymers, ligands for catalysis, and advanced organic materials.
- Chemical Biology Probes: Used in the design and synthesis of molecular probes for studying enzyme mechanisms and biological pathways.
Basic Information
| Product Name | o-(2-Trifluoromethyl-Phenyl)-Hydroxylamine |
| CAS No. | 160725-42-8 |
| Molecular Formula | C7H6F3NO |
| Molecular Weight | 177.12 g/mol |
| Synonyms | 2-(Trifluoromethyl)phenylhydroxylamine; o-(Trifluoromethyl)phenylhydroxylamine; N-Hydroxy-2-(trifluoromethyl)aniline; 1-Amino-2-(trifluoromethyl)benzene N-oxide; 2-(Trifluoromethyl)aniline, N-hydroxy-; (2-Trifluoromethylphenyl)hydroxylamine; 2-Trifluoromethylphenylhydroxylamine; 2-(Trifluoromethyl)hydroxylaniline |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en) after opening to prevent degradation.
